Kenny Chesney Went Above and Beyond for Megan Moroney’s End-Of-Tour Gift

With hit songs like “Tennessee Orange” and “Am I Okay?” Megan Moroney is rapidly ascending the country music ladder. The CMA’s reigning New Artist of the Year, 27, caught the attention of country legend Kenny Chesney, who invited her on last year’s Sun Goes Down Tour as his opening act. As the two grew especially close during their time on the road together, the “She Thinks My Tractor’s Sexy” crooner wanted to get her an extra-special end-of-tour gift. And according to Moroney, he succeeded.

Kenny Chesney Had to Sneakily Deliver Megan Moroney’s Present

Megan Moroney took many things away from her time on tour with Kenny Chesney—namely, “ice bathing and sauna’ing,” the “No Caller ID” singer revealed during a recent appearance on the Taste of Country Nights podcast.

Now that she shares his addiction, the Country Music Hall of Fame inductee paid for Moroney to have her own personal sauna installed in her Nashville home. What’s more, he even managed to surprise her with it, somehow.

“He actually had someone come and custom-build it to my house,” Moroney said. “Apparently they had to do it when I wasn’t in town, I don’t know how he snuck around. I guess it was someone on my team that helped?”

While the Sun Goes Down Tour wrapped up in August, the pair’s friendship has endured. “Pure joy all summer. Onstage and off,” Chesney wrote in a sweet comment on Moroney’s Instagram page. “God I’m gonna miss it. I didn’t know you 5 months ago. Now I can’t imagine not having you in my life… It was one of the highlights of my life becoming friends with you. I sure love Megan Moroney.”

How Their New Collab Came to Be

To the excitement of all who love them, Megan Moroney and Kenny Chesney recently announced that their new duet, “You Had to Be There,” drops Friday, May 9.

During her Taste of Country Nights interview, Moroney revealed that she wrote the song for Chesney as a thank you after the Sun Goes Down tour. However, she had to rely on liquid courage to pitch “You Had to Be There” to the four-time Entertainer of the Year.

“There were definitely some pain killers involved — which, pain killers are a St. John’s drink, I’m not talking about taking pain killers,” she said.
